At Home Date Night

Since LO arrived going out on dates is less frequent... So I am hoping some of you will share your favorite ways to stay connected with your SO at home.

DH and I are going to pick a book to read together so we can talk about it in our own personal "book club".

What kinds of things are you ladies doing?

  • After putting baby down we've enjoyed a glass a wine, favorite dessert and watched comedy. ... we use to go to the improv a lot, so it's our version of the improv date night at home.
    BabyFruit Ticker

     

  • I like the Dating Divas website for date ideas. Their dates are generally pretty cutesy (which I like) and require some prep. They even have a whole category for at home dates. I usually use their ideas as inspiration and make them easier and more our style.

    We have also embraced lunch dates! Much easier to pull off!
  • We will make dinner or order take out and eat it out on the patio after the babies go to bed.  It makes it feel like we're "out" to eat because we're not in a kitchen with a sink full of dirty dishes or in a living room surrounded by toys.  We have had some of our best conversations out there.  We save the money of a sitter by just bringing the monitor out with us.

  • It's tough to find time to bond with DH lately since he works an awful swing shift this month (mon tues 6 am - 2 pm, wed 2 pm-10pm, fri sat 10 pm-6am) and I work 9-5 mon-fri. most days he has to leave for work by 8:30 pm or be in bed to sleep by then, and LO doesn't go to bed until 8:30 so that doesn't leave time for mommy/daddy alone time.

    yesterday though DH said screw sleep and just stayed up with me until 11pm. we sat in the hot tub and drank wine and talked. it was glorious! we don't have a baby monitor because the house is so small we never needed one, so we called each other and put the phones on speakerphone with one on mute so LO couldn't hear us but we could hear him and left one near his crib. it worked great. I think even if you don't have a hot tub it would be a lot of fun to do this in the bath tub (light some candles!) or even just have wine out on the porch swing. chill out, look at the stars :)

    We also have lit the fire pit a few times. I've even put sleeping LO in his carrier and just worn him out there. this has been fun but not quite as fun since the mosquitoes are bad in the far back of the yard. maybe this fall will be better.
